What to Eat

Fort Worth is home to a variety of restaurants, serving everything from traditional American fare to international cuisine. Here are a few of the must-try dishes: * Barbecue: Fort Worth is known for its barbecue, and there are several great barbecue restaurants to choose from. * Tex-Mex: Tex-Mex is a fusion of Mexican and American cuisine, and Fort Worth has some of the best Tex-Mex restaurants in the state. * Fried catfish: Fried catfish is a popular dish in Fort Worth, and it is often served with hush puppies and coleslaw.

Where to Go

Fort Worth is home to a variety of attractions, including museums, historical sites, and parks. Here are a few of the must-see places: * The Fort Worth Stockyards: The Fort Worth Stockyards is a National Historic District that is home to a variety of shops, restaurants, and attractions. * The Kimbell Art Museum: The Kimbell Art Museum is home to a collection of European and American art from the 13th century to the present. * The Fort Worth Botanic Gardens: The Fort Worth Botanic Gardens are home to a variety of plants and flowers from around the world.
